开发多小程序是一个复杂的过程,涉及到多个步骤和策略。以下是高效开发多小程序的实用指南:
1. 明确目标和需求
在开始任何项目之前,首先需要明确你的小程序的目标和需求。这将帮助你确定需要哪些功能,以及如何设计小程序以满足这些需求。
2. 选择合适的开发框架
根据你的小程序类型和目标选择合适的开发框架。例如,对于电商类小程序,可以选择微信小程序;而对于游戏类小程序,可能需要使用Unity或Unreal Engine等游戏引擎。
3. 规划技术栈
根据小程序的需求和功能,选择合适的编程语言、数据库、服务器、云服务等技术栈。确保所选技术栈能够满足小程序的性能、安全性和可扩展性要求。
4. 设计用户界面
设计直观、易用的用户界面,确保用户体验良好。可以使用Sketch、Adobe XD等工具进行设计。同时,要考虑到不同设备和屏幕尺寸的适配问题。
5. 实现核心功能
根据需求文档,逐步实现小程序的核心功能。这可能包括用户认证、数据存储、网络通信、数据处理等。在开发过程中,要不断测试和优化代码,确保小程序的稳定性和性能。
6. 测试和调试
在开发过程中,要进行充分的测试和调试,以确保小程序的功能正常运行,没有明显的bug或性能问题。可以使用Jest、Mocha等测试框架进行单元测试和集成测试。
7. 部署和维护
将小程序部署到服务器上,并确保其能够稳定运行。同时,要定期更新和维护小程序,修复发现的问题,并根据用户反馈进行优化。
8. 数据分析与优化
收集和使用小程序的数据,分析用户行为和偏好,以便进行优化。可以使用Google Analytics、Firebase等工具进行数据分析。
9. 持续迭代
根据用户反馈和市场变化,不断迭代和完善小程序,增加新功能,改进用户体验。
10. 遵循开发规范
确保遵循良好的开发规范,包括代码风格、命名约定、版本控制等。这将有助于提高团队的开发效率和代码质量。
通过以上步骤,你可以高效地开发多小程序,并确保它们能够满足用户需求,提供良好的用户体验。